WebOct 24, 2024 · The MCAT score range is from 472 to 528. The midpoint combined score is 500. Source: American Association of Medical Colleges After you take the MCAT, you will … WebDec 27, 2024 · What’s a Good MCAT Score? A perfect MCAT score is 528, which requires scoring 132 in each of the 4 sections. Of course, a perfect score is not required to get into your top choice medical schools. A good MCAT score is different for everyone and largely depends on the schools you hope to gain acceptance to.

WebFor example, a GPA over 3.79 combined with an MCAT score above 517 boosts your chances of medical school acceptance to 83.2%, while the same GPA score combined with an MCAT score of 506-509 means your chances drop to 52.6%.
